Chipping Campden is one of the most beautiful and historic wool market towns of the North Cotswolds. It is famous for the curving high street and mellow stone houses and sits in a fold in the Cotswold Hills, straddling the River Cam in an area of outstanding natural beauty, the surrounding countryside is breathtaking.
The town has changed little over the years and is still the focus for much of the local rural community. There are a wide variety of restaurants and pubs and an excellent range of shops selling local produce, gifts and antiques. The town is associated with the Arts and Crafts movement and offers a wide range of attractions for visitors, including medieval architecture, historic gardens and monuments, regular markets and unique shops. There are also numerous beautiful, quaint little villages waiting to be explored within a short drive.
Cultural events are held throughout the year, such as the Chipping Campden Music Festival, the Open Gardens weekend and the Robert Dover's Olimpick Games, described as “the first stirrings of Britain’s Olympic beginnings”. Stratford on Avon and Blenheim Palace, the birthplaces of Shakespeare and Churchill, are cultural gems situated nearby, as are the dreaming spires of Oxford. Cheltenham and the famous racing festival lie 15 miles away.
